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Batley to Shettleston start from as little as £24.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Batley to Shettleston start from £69.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Batley to Shettleston are available for £79.20 one way

Amenities and Facilities at Batley Station

Batley Train Station may be quaint, but it offers all the essential amenities to make your travel experience as convenient as possible. Though there is no staffed ticket office available, the station is equipped with ticket machines from which you can collect your tickets bought online. If assistance is needed, passengers can rely on customer help points strategically placed throughout the station.

Travelers with accessibility needs will find Batley Station partially accommodating. There's step-free access to platform 1 (leading to Leeds), though platform 2 (the Huddersfield direction) is accessible only via steps. For those needing additional assistance, staff and conductors are available via help points, ready to ensure your journey proceeds smoothly.

Offering CCTV surveillance, limited car parking, and bicycle storage (though sheltered options aren't available), Batley is perfect for those who prefer simple, secure travel arrangements. While the station lacks extensive refreshment facilities, it's a place where efficiency meets simplicity, making it easy for seasoned travelers to navigate swiftly.

Station Facilities

At Shettleston, passengers can find a ticket office operational from Monday to Saturday between 6:00 and 19:48, along with accessible ticket machines available for a seamless ticket-purchasing experience. Handy ticket collection from machines for online purchases is also possible. For those who require assistance, the station offers an induction loop and helpful staff available during opening hours.

While you won't find refreshment facilities or ATMs at the station, its location opens options nearby. Additionally, there's provision for bike storage, ensuring rail commuters with bicycles are well accommodated, although cycle hire isn't currently offered. Car parking facilities are impressive, with 60 spaces available free of charge, including two convenient spaces for disabled users.

Accessibility & Support

Accessibility is a key focus at Shettleston, with step-free access to some parts of the station, though there are stairs between platforms. While wheelchairs aren’t available, ramps for train access cater to passengers with mobility needs. Note the absence of accessible toilets and baby-changing facilities, so planning accordingly is advised. CCTV throughout the station provides additional security, reassuring travelers at all times.
